Ergonomics of OR Displays: Mount/Arm/Cart Positioning and Glare Control

OR scene showing a surgeon facing a 55″ wall-mounted display centered at eyeline within a 30–40° viewing cone; nearby 32″ arm monitor and 27″ cart screen; note “Fix lights first for AR glare control.”

Mount for the eyes, not the wall: center the screen in a 30–40° viewing cone at true working height, then choose 55″ wall for team awareness, ≈32″ arm for reach and mixed views, and ≈27″ cart for tight solo work. Kill glare by fixing lights first, placing the panel second, and letting AR optics finish the job.
